About Norman North HS

Norman North HS is a public high school in Norman, OK, part of NORMAN. Norman North HS serves approximately 2,369 students, and covers grades 9th-12th, and has a 19.9:1 student-teacher ratio. Norman North HS has a current MySchoolScout rating of 7.2 out of 10 and ranks #374 of 1,750 schools in OK.

Structured state assessment records for Norman North HS show 57%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 68%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).

Norman North High School is part of Norman Public Schools (NPS), which is the eighth largest school district in Oklahoma 2 . The district serves over 16,000 students across 26 schools and academies with more than 2,250 staff members 1 . NPS reports having one of the highest numbers of National Merit Semifinalists and Finalists, U.S. Blue Ribbon Schools, and Oklahoma Reward Schools in the state 2 . The district also notes a high number of National Board Certified teachers 2 . Students in the district have achieved state championships in athletics, fine arts, and academic competitions 2 . NPS educators have received significant honors, including two Oklahoma State Teachers of the Year, eight Oklahoma Teacher of the Year Finalists, 14 Presidential Awards of Excellence in Mathematics and Science Teaching, and two Milken Family Foundation National Educator Awards 2 . The district emphasizes a student-centered approach focused on holistic development through innovative programs in academics, fine arts, and athletics 1 .

Programs & Offerings

AP/IB Programs4 AP courses offered
26.3% participation·State avg: 2.2 AP courses·CRDC 2021-22
Athletics14sports offered
7 boys'·7 girls'·31 teams (incl. JV)·CRDC 2021-22
Advanced STEM Courses5 of 5 advanced subjects offered
Algebra II, Advanced Math, Calculus, Chemistry, Physics·CRDC 2021-22
Gifted & Talented Program Available
This school offers a gifted and talented program for qualifying students. · CRDC 2021-22
